After AmaZulu and Milford booked their spot in the Nedbank Cup Last 16, all teams to enter Wednesday’s draw have been confirmed.
AmaZulu needed extra-time to beat 10-men Polokwane City on Tuesday evening. Taariq Fielies scored the opener after 10 minutes and Batlhabane Moketsi got sent off for Rise and Shine after 33.
However, Lebohang Nkaki equalized from the spot for Polokwane in the 45th minute, and managed to hold onto the draw after 90 minutes, forcing extra-time. But eventually AmaZulu found the winner via Thandolwenkosi Ngwenya in the 113th minute.
In the other Tuesday tie, Milford beat Soweto Super United on penalties after the game had ended 1-1 in 120 minutes.
The Last 16 draw will take place at the SuperSport TV studios in Randburg on Wednesday evening from 18:30.
